Transaction 37c780ded95404c3d74be71e4a83e5c10f2f5cec26b852b46d5264fe1fe86e5a

2 Input
2 Outputs
  • 37c780ded95404c3d74be71e4a83e5c10f2f5cec26b852b46d5264fe1fe86e5a:0
  • value  1626086032
    address  3AXHUcAmZV6CcGWWx2fLG4y3iussx3rs2m
  • 37c780ded95404c3d74be71e4a83e5c10f2f5cec26b852b46d5264fe1fe86e5a:1
  • value  7373753808
    address  3BMEXt2gwBuqBdGbTbMCMMAPsLRKXU5Yzw